That reformatting created two extra qualification places for the nations that finish the season with the highest UEFA coefficient rankings.<\/p>\n<p>Under that arrangement, if England finishes as one of the two top-ranked countries in the coefficient table, five Premier League clubs rather than the usual four would qualify for next season\u2019s Champions League. Those five sides would enter directly into the new league phase.<\/p>\n<p>England currently leads the UEFA coefficient standings, a position built on strong league-phase showings by English clubs and solid results across recent campaigns. The table shows England on an average of 22.847 and total points of 205.625, with Spain second on 18.406 (147.250) and Germany third on 18.142 (127.000). Italy, Portugal, France and Poland follow in the listed rankings.<\/p>\n<p>Coefficient scores are calculated on the basis of clubs\u2019 performances in UEFA competition across the past five seasons, with results and progression in the Champions League, Europa League and Conference League all contributing to a nation\u2019s ranking.<\/p>\n<p>That said, England\u2019s advantage is not guaranteed. The underperformance of several Premier League sides in the knockout phase has complicated the picture. There are currently nine Premier League clubs competing across UEFA\u2019s three competitions, but only Aston Villa won the first leg of their last-16 tie. Manchester City, Chelsea and Tottenham Hotspur all suffered three-goal defeats in their first legs, while Liverpool and Nottingham Forest lost 1\u20130. Arsenal and Newcastle United drew their first-leg matches.<\/p>\n<p>Spain still retains a strong continental presence with six teams remaining and clubs such as Real Madrid, Barcelona, Atl\u00e9tico Madrid and Rayo Vallecano in favourable positions to progress beyond the round of 16. The coefficients will continue to change as knockout ties conclude, and England\u2019s final standing will determine whether a top-five Premier League finish is enough to guarantee five Champions League places.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>England lead the UEFA coefficients; if retained top-five in the Premier League gives five CL places.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":8441,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"open","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[711,172],"tags":[1162,1047],"class_list":["post-8442","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-aston-villa","category-epl","tag-analytics","tag-champions-league"],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/8442","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/1"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=8442"}],"version-history":[{"count":0,"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/8442\/revisions"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/8441"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=8442"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=8442"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.weplayfpl.com\/news-articles\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=8442"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
